2. Obstacles Of Recycling Solar Panels
It is widely accepted that recycling solar panels has several environmental advantages, however, it is additionally true that the process isn't without its obstacles. But what exactly are these difficulties? Allow's investigate even more.
Among the greatest problems with recycling solar panels is the complexity of the task itself. It can be hard to break down the different parts, such as glass and steel, to be reused separately. In addition, photovoltaic panel producers commonly have a mix of materials utilized in their items that makes sorting them a lot more complex. Additionally, there are security and health and wellness dangers included with managing damaged glass or breathing in fumes from thawing components.
One more key difficulty related to recycling photovoltaic panels is cost. Many nations do not have enough infrastructure or sources to effectively recycle these items which brings about higher expenses for companies attempting to do so. Furthermore, due to the specialized nature of recycling photovoltaic panels, this can produce a monetary burden on firms attempting to remain compliant with laws. Eventually, these costs could be passed down to consumers making it hard for them to afford renewable energy resources.

3. Methods For Reusing Solar Panels
As the world strives for a more sustainable future, reusing photovoltaic panels is an increasingly preferred job. Among this growing passion, however, we have to think about the methods that are in place to make it feasible.
To start with, many companies have applied a 'take-back' system wherein old or broken solar panels can be collected and sent out to their respective manufacturing facilities for recycling. In this manner, the products have the ability to be recycled in the building of brand-new products. In addition, some communities have actually also started using rewards for people wanting to reuse their solar panels; this can vary from tax breaks to free shipping prices.
Additionally, technology has come to be increasingly innovative when it comes to recycling solar panels-- with specialist makers efficient in separating out all the different parts within them. For example, by using AI-powered robotic arms, these machines can remove valuable materials such as copper and aluminium while likewise throwing away hazardous waste safely.
